Yes, Carlisle offers a variety of family-friendly activities suitable for all age groups. Families can explore attractions like the Tullie House Museum and Art Gallery, which often has interactive exhibits for children. The nearby Carlisle Castle provides an exciting outing with its rich history and guided tours. Outdoor enthusiasts can take advantage of parks for picnics and recreational activities, such as walking trails in Milton Hill Park, ensuring that families have plenty of options to keep everyone entertained during their stay.
